Dhvanil Raval

Great menu but not enough attention to the way food is cooked, which seems to be reflecting in how well they do business. We went on a Sunday afternoon during peak lunch hour and were surprised to find the place totally empty. Ordered the ribs, and was mildly disappointed. They are advertised to be melt-in-the-mouth but that only corresponds to the fat on the ribs. They were disproportionately coated with sauce (sauce was great, though), and were unevenly hot, which made me feel they were unevenly cooked. The meat was tough and stringy. Ordered the bread with bacon-garlic-mayo. The dip was amazing, the bread was far below expectations. It was mostly cold, and with no variety as per description. There were only two breads, regular wheat bread and garlic bread (which is a bit too much garlic when you already have garlic in the mayo), instead of the multiple kinds of bread as per menu description. Go here for a good value for money and unique menu options, but only with a group of friends - the quantities are really not curated for a table of two. Do not expect blockbuster cooking despite the uniqueness of the menu.
